
After the 59th Venice Biennale and the 15th Documenta in Kassel, 2022 concludes the international exhibitions of contemporary art Manifesta 14, the only European nomadic biennale presented this year in Pristina.
The Manifesta was first organized in Rotterdam in 1996 and has since been held regularly throughout Europe. Kosovo was chosen because of the geographical importance of the Western Balkans for Europe’s recent history and future, organizers say. Pristina, a rapidly changing urban center at the crossroads of Southern and Eastern Europe, allows artists to explore how contemporary culture can express such complex geopolitical identities. Duration up to 30/10.
